Plot Summary

The seventh and final season of Orange Is the New Black brings Piper Chapman back to the outside world as she struggles to adjust to a life without the structured confines of Litchfield Penitentiary. Meanwhile, her former inmates navigate the complex realities of life within and outside the prison walls, dealing with newfound freedoms and lingering consequences. The season concludes the interwoven stories of the women, exploring themes of redemption, systemic injustice, and the enduring power of female relationships.

Critical Reception

The final season of Orange Is the New Black received generally positive reviews, with critics praising its emotional depth and satisfying conclusion to the series. While some noted a slight decline in quality from earlier seasons, most agreed that the show managed to deliver a poignant and fitting farewell to its beloved characters. Audience reception was also largely favorable, appreciating the closure provided to the long-running narrative.
